A story based on real experiences of an immigrant in the UK, exploring themes of home, belonging and finding your identity as a foreigner in a big city. The excitement of it. The confusion of it. The loneliness of it. The longing to belong. Somewhere. To someone. It's a play about endless searching for the place that feels right. That feels like home. It's about racing towards the future and running away from the past, until you cannot run anymore and all you are left with is the present. A train station. And a train to Brixton.


A debut play from actor/writer Zuzana Spacirova, in which she reflects on her experiences of moving from Eastern Europe to London.


Featuring a talking self checkout, binge watching Eastenders and painfully relatable life choices.
